I don't often rewatch anime, but this is one of those few anime that I have rewatched. The anime is a short OVA, with only three episodes, so it's a good 'quick' anime to watch in-between other longer series, or just if a break is needed. The story is a simple concept, but I find that to be best, considering the length of the series. However, despite its simplicity, it is still very sweet and quite 'chill' in my opinion (the content doesn't get you hyped up or anxious). The art style of the animation is also very simple, but rather than take away from the overall enjoyment, it adds to it. The music in the series is very calm, and the characters are not especially complex. However, despite the lack of 'action' in the series, there is more of a focus on the characters themselves and their development and growth, and this is something that I hope for in any series I watch. For this series to achieve this in only three episodes is admirable.
Overall, what I've found is that the series as a whole encapsulates and owns a simple and relaxed atmosphere. It doesn't aim to send you on a rollercoaster of emotion, make you stressed or make you laugh. It's just a short and sweet anime you could watch in one sitting and just enjoy.
